🧠 What Is Smart Packaging?

Smart packaging refers to innovative packaging technologies that do more than just hold food.

It can:

  • 📊 Monitor freshness 
  • 💨 Control oxygen and moisture 
  • 🛡️ Fight bacteria 
  • 📆 Show expiry in real-time 

All of this — without changing how the packaging looks or feels.

🔍 Types of Smart Packaging You’re Already Using

1. 🧼 Antimicrobial Coatings

Some meat and cheese packs now contain invisible coatings that kill bacteria on contact.

✅ Slows down spoilage
✅ Increases shelf life by up to 30%
✅ Safe and approved for food use

2. 🌬️ Modified Atmosphere Packaging (MAP)

That fresh salad or bread you love?
It’s packed with a special mix of gases like CO₂ and nitrogen to slow spoilage.

✅ Keeps color, texture, and crunch
✅ Reduces oxygen exposure = less mold

3. 🔁 Moisture Control Layers

Used in snacks, dry fruits, and biscuits.
These packs absorb extra humidity and stop the contents from going soggy.

✅ Crunchy till the last bite
✅ No preservatives needed

4. 🟢 Time-Temperature Indicators

Coming soon to your freezer aisle — color-changing labels that tell you if the food was stored at the right temperature.

✅ Protects against spoiled frozen food
✅ Great for meat, milk, and ready meals
